Apoll in 2017 reported that 705 out of 1023 adults in a certain country believe that marijuana should be legalized. when this poll about the same subject was first conducted in 1969, only 12% of the adults of the country supported legalization. assume the conditions for using the clt are met. complete question 1 through3 below.

1) find and interpret a 99% confidence interval for the proportion of adults in the country in 2017 that believe marijuana should be legalized.

select one:

a. (0.661, 0.717)
b. (0.096, 0.143)
c. (0.094, 0.146)
d. (0.652, 0.726)

2)find and interpret a 95% confidence interval for this population parameter.

select one:

a. (0.096, 0.143)
b. (0.661, 0.718)
c. (0.1, 0.139)
d. (0.652, 0.726)

3) without computing it, how would the margin of error of a 90% confidence interval compare with the margin of error for the 95% and 99% intervals? construct the 90% confidence interval to see if your prediction was correct. how would a 90% interval compare with the others in the margin of error?

select one:

a. the margin of error of a 90% confidence interval will be less than the margin of error for the 95% and 99% confidence intervals because intervals get wider with increasing confidence level.
b. the margin of error of a 90% confidence interval will be less than the margin of error for the 95% and 99% confidence intervals because intervals get narrower with increasing confidence level.
c. the margin of error of a 90% confidence interval will be more than the margin of error for the 95% and 99% confidence intervals because intervals get wider with increasing confidence level.
d. the margin of error of a 90% confidence interval will be greater than the margin of error for the 95% confidence interval and less than the margin of error for the 99% confidence interval because intervals get wider with increasing confidence level.
